William H. Berentsen is the author of Contemporary Europe: A Geographic Analysis, 7th Edition, published by Wiley. Where can you find expert commentary on the geography of Europe? Right Here! Look inside this book and youll find insights from a remarkable team of European Geography specialists, almost all of whom have lived in Europe for extended periods of time. Now in its seventh edition, this comprehensive book draws upon the knowledge and experience of its contributors to provide an overview of contemporary Europe. Focusing on topical and regional aspects separately, it allows you to pick what to study when. Thematic chapters permit a cross-national overview by topic. Regional chapters give a detailed overview of a specific region, including all European regions and major countries. This authoritative text maintains a contemporary focus while supplying historical information, which provides a context for current conditions. In addition, the seventh edition features:
- Updated material which includes the most current developments in European geography as witnessed by the authors, all experts in their areas of study, during their frequent stays in Europe.
- Reduction in overall length and a thorough reorganization of material for a clearer presentation.
- More photos and in-depth information on special topics have been added to increase student interest.
- Expanded coverage of the EU and major issues facing it.
